SonicJobs Logo
Left arrow iconBack to search

Project Manager

DCC branded
Posted 11 hours ago, valid for 6 days
Location

London, Greater London EC1R 0WX

Salary

£48,000 - £60,000 per annum

info
Contract type

Full Time

By applying, a Reed account will be created for you. Reed's Terms & Conditions and Privacy policy will apply.

Sonic Summary

info
  • The DCC is seeking a Project Manager for their Service Delivery function, located in London or Manchester, offering a competitive salary and benefits.
  • The role requires a minimum of 5 years of demonstrable project management experience and excellent communication skills to engage with executive-level stakeholders.
  • Key responsibilities include project planning, risk management, budget and resource management, stakeholder communication, problem-solving, and documentation.
  • Desirable qualifications include a bachelor's degree and PRINCE2 or PMP accreditation, along with experience in a regulated environment and knowledge of the UK energy market.
  • The DCC promotes a supportive work environment, emphasizing personal development and the importance of their team in transforming Britain's energy system.

Project Manager with Smart DCC

London or Manchester

Competitive Salary plus benefits

Role

The Service Delivery function is changing and evolving as part of the new Design, Build, Run (DBR) operating model that has recently been established. As such we need an increased demand in programme capability and leadership skills and behaviours to drive the DBR capability framework forward for success.

DCC is looking to appoint a Project Manager within the Service Delivery (SD) function. The Service Delivery function is responsible for delivering changes to the smart metering ecosystem and ensuring successful transition into live operation. Current programmes include delivering 4G Communications Hubs and Networks (CH&N), the Data Service Provider (DSP) Data System and Market-Wide Half-Hourly Settlement (MHHS).

What will you be doing?

Your delivery support responsibility will be through assignment to a programme or portfolio where you will report to a Programme Manager.

You will be responsible for ensuring that programmes and projects are managed effectively and efficiently according to DCC standards and best practice.

Your accountabilities will include:

·      Project Planning

·      Risk Management

·      Budget and Resource Management

·      Stakeholder Communication

·      Problem solving

·      Documentation and reporting

What are we looking for?

Essential: 

·      Minimum 5 years’ demonstrable experience in project management

·      Excellent communication skills (oral and written) with the ability to gain credibility with executive level stakeholders.

·      Proficiency in Project Management tools (e.g., MS Project, Clarity), MS Project and Excel

Desirable: 

·      Bachelor's degree.

·      PRINCE2 or PMP Project Management Professional accreditation or similar.

·      Experience working in a highly regulated environment.

·      Experience of the UK energy market.

About the DCC:

At the DCC, we believe in making Britain more connected, so we can all lead smarter, greener lives. That desire to make a difference is what drives us every day and it wouldn’t be possible without our people. Each person at the DCC brings a special kind of power to the business, and if you join us, we’ll give you the means to unleash yours. Here, we depend on each other and hold each other accountable. You have the power to challenge and make change, to take the initiative and enjoy real responsibility. Whether it’s doing purposeful work, helping us grow or building the career you want – we’ll give you the support to do it all. Our secure network for smart meters is transforming Britain’s energy system and helping the country’s fight against climate change: we want you to be part of our journey.

Company benefits:

The DCC’s continued success depends on our people. It’s important to us that you enjoy coming to work, and feel healthy, happy and rewarded. In this role, you’ll have access to a range of benefits which you can choose from to create a personalized plan unique to your lifestyle.

Complete your application, so we can learn more about you. Your application will be carefully considered, and you’ll hear from us regarding its progress.

Join the DCC and discover the power of you.

What to do now

Choose ‘Apply now’ to fill out our short application, so that we can find out more about you.  

As a Disability Confident member, DCC is committed to ensuring an inclusive and accessible recruitment process. If you require any reasonable adjustments, need a copy of this job advert in an alternative format.

Capita Opportunity Statement:

The parent company, Capita Plc*, are a leading UK provider of technology enabled business services. We’re supporting and improving the lives of millions of people every day and we can only do this with the right people in place, working towards a shared goal. We encourage an open, honest working environment where everyone can be true to themselves, and people are valued for their differences. We’re always challenging each other to learn and improve, because we know when we work together, we can deliver better outcomes. We work across such a huge range of businesses and sectors, that you’ll have the opportunity to grow and develop your career in any number of directions. You’ll also become part of a network of 63,000 experienced, innovative, and dedicated individuals across multiple disciplines and sectors. There are countless opportunities to learn new skills and develop in your career, and we’ll provide the support you need to do deliver. Our purpose is to create a better outcome for you.

Apply now in a few quick clicks

By applying, a Reed account will be created for you. Reed's Terms & Conditions and Privacy policy will apply.